To honor, recognize and celebrate the life of Linda Kanney, 1949-2023
Body
WHEREAS, Linda Kanney was born on January 8, 1949 in Huntington, West Virginia; and
WHEREAS, Linda spent her childhood in West Virginia before coming to Columbus, where she enrolled in classes at Columbus State and Franklin University; and
WHEREAS, Linda was a passionate advocate who dedicated all of herself to others, with a particular focus on improving the lives of Central Ohio’s Black women and girls; and
WHEREAS, Linda advanced this mission through countless organizations, most notably the YWCA, where she served in several leadership roles at the local and national level, and as the chartering president of the National Coalition of 100 Black Women, Inc. Central Ohio Chapter; and
WHEREAS, Linda was recognized for her work with several prestigious awards, including the Walter and Marion English Martin Luther King Racial Justice Award, the 2021 YWCA Woman of Achievement Award, and the International Women’s Day Starfish Award; and
WHEREAS, outside of her activism, Linda was a beloved member of the Columbus community who regularly hosted holiday parties with 30+ guests, where she was always the first one on the dance floor after serving a legendary meal, and a loving parent, grandparent, friend, and loved one; and
WHEREAS, the City of Columbus extends its sincere condolences to the friends and family of Linda Kanney, including her husband Fredrick, children Francine and Cameron, siblings Dwane and Ernest, five grandchildren, scores of nieces, nephews, and cousins, and countless other loved ones; now, therefore,
BE IT RESOLVED BY THE CO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F COLUMBUS: That this Council does hereby honor, recognize, and celebrate the life of Linda Kanney.
